
Man acquitted of dowry death charges
The local court of SAS Nagar has acquitted a resident of Mullanpur of the charges of dowry death on Friday. Mohan Singh got acquittal due to lack of evidence against him.

Dera Bassi resident Bhupinder Singh, the complainant of the case, said his daughter had married Mohan. But after the marriage, Mohan and his family members had started harassing her and demanded dowry.
On October 22, 2010 victim Rajinder Kaur committed suicide, but the police did not find and injury mark on her body. A case was registered on the complaint of the father of the deceased.
